>gnl|CDD|147949 pfam06068, TIP49, TIP49 C-terminus. This family consists of the
C-terminal region of several eukaryotic and archaeal
RuvB-like 1 (Pontin or TIP49a) and RuvB-like 2 (Reptin
or TIP49b) proteins. The N-terminal domain contains the
pfam00004 domain. In zebrafish, the liebeskummer (lik)
mutation, causes development of hyperplastic embryonic
hearts. lik encodes Reptin, a component of a
DNA-stimulated ATPase complex. Beta-catenin and Pontin,
a DNA-stimulated ATPase that is often part of complexes
with Reptin, are in the same genetic pathways. The
Reptin/Pontin ratio serves to regulate heart growth
during development, at least in part via the
beta-catenin pathway. TBP-interacting protein 49 (TIP49)
was originally identified as a TBP-binding protein, and
two related proteins are encoded by individual genes,
tip49a and b. Although the function of this gene family
has not been elucidated, they are supposed to play a
critical role in nuclear events because they interact
with various kinds of nuclear factors and have DNA
helicase activities.TIP49a has been suggested to act as
an autoantigen in some patients with autoimmune
diseases.

>gnl|CDD|233847 TIGR02397, dnaX_nterm, DNA polymerase III, subunit gamma and tau.
This model represents the well-conserved first ~ 365
amino acids of the translation of the dnaX gene. The
full-length product of the dnaX gene in the model
bacterium E. coli is the DNA polymerase III tau subunit.
A translational frameshift leads to early termination
and a truncated protein subunit gamma, about 1/3 shorter
than tau and present in roughly equal amounts. This
frameshift mechanism is not necessarily universal for
species with DNA polymerase III but appears conserved in
the exterme thermophile Thermus thermophilis [DNA
metabolism, DNA replication, recombination, and repair].

>gnl|CDD|99707 cd00009, AAA, The AAA+ (ATPases Associated with a wide variety of
cellular Activities) superfamily represents an ancient
group of ATPases belonging to the ASCE (for additional
strand, catalytic E) division of the P-loop NTPase fold.
The ASCE division also includes ABC, RecA-like,
VirD4-like, PilT-like, and SF1/2 helicases. Members of
the AAA+ ATPases function as molecular chaperons, ATPase
subunits of proteases, helicases, or nucleic-acid
stimulated ATPases. The AAA+ proteins contain several
distinct features in addition to the conserved
alpha-beta-alpha core domain structure and the Walker A
and B motifs of the P-loop NTPases.

>gnl|CDD|200596 cd10974, CE4_CDA_like_1, Putative catalytic domain of chitin
deacetylase-like proteins with additional chitin-binding
peritrophin-A domain (ChBD) and/or a low-density
lipoprotein receptor class A domain (LDLa). Chitin
deacetylases (CDAs, EC 3.5.1.41) are secreted
metalloproteins belonging to a family of extracellular
chitin-modifying enzymes that catalyze the
N-deacetylation of chitin, a beta-1,4-linked
N-acetylglucosamine polymer, to form chitosan, a polymer
of beta-(1,4)-linked d-glucosamine residues. CDAs have
been isolated and characterized from various bacterial
and fungal species and belong to the larger carbohydrate
esterase 4 (CE4) superfamily. This family includes many
CDA-like proteins mainly from insects, which contain a
putative CDA-like catalytic domain similar to the
catalytic NodB homology domain of CE4 esterases. In
addition to the CDA-like domain, family members contain
two additional domains, a chitin-binding peritrophin-A
domain (ChBD) and a low-density lipoprotein receptor
class A domain (LDLa), or have the ChBD domain but do
not have the LDLa domain.

>gnl|CDD|234198 TIGR03400, 18S_RNA_Rcl1p, 18S rRNA biogenesis protein RCL1.
Members of this strictly eukaryotic protein family are
not RNA 3'-phosphate cyclase (6.5.1.4), but rather a
homolog with a distinct function, found in the nucleolus
and required for ribosomal RNA processing. Homo sapiens
has both a member of this RCL (RNA terminal phosphate
cyclase like) family and EC 6.5.1.4, while Saccharomyces
has a member of this family only.
